The present invention relates to a biomarker composition containing carnitine for diagnosing radiation exposure and diagnosing method using the same. More specifically, carnitine, which is increased in a human fibroblast by radiation exposure, is used as a biomarker. The present invention also provides: a kit for diagnosing radiation exposure using the same biomarker; and a diagnosing method whereby the amount of increase of the carnitine biomarker of a biological sample, separated from an object to be tested, is compared with the amount of increase of a carnitine biomarker, separated from a control group. Therefore, the biomarker composition enables a user to quickly and efficiently determine whether a patient is exposed to radiation or not, and consequently to increase an effect of treatment on the patient exposed to radiation. |
